There are 200 students in the 8th grade class at Alleghany Middle School. Of these students, 8% play basketball and 14% play soc
sergeinik [125]

Answer:

The probability that a student plays either basketball or soccer is 19% or 0.19.

Step-by-step explanation:

Let A be the event that student play basketball and  B be the event that student play soccer.

P(A)=8\%

P(B)=14\%

It is given that 6 students play on both teams.

P(A\cap B)=\frac{6}{200}\times 100=3\%

We have to find the probability that a student plays either basketball or soccer.

P(A\cup B)=P(A)+P(B)-(A\cap B)

P(A\cup B)=8\%+14\%-3\%

P(A\cup B)=19\%

Therefore the probability that a student plays either basketball or soccer is 19% or 0.19.
